This is a continuation of rB39f005eae8eed8b939579aff8c9a05a4f50e5e38 Now all the fields where we check for object type in RNA (like rna_Curve_object_poll) will have a safe guard for when this isn't the case. For example when loading files that has missing object libraries and all missing objects are replaced with empties (placeholders). Reviewed By: Brecht Differential Revision: http://developer.blender.org/D5425
